Actress Adesua Etomi recount near death experience in June

Nollywood actress Adesua Etomi-Wellington has shared details of a life-threatening health scare she experienced in June while in the United Kingdom with her husband, Banky W, and their two sons.

In a heartfelt post on Instagram, the actress revealed that she underwent an unexpected surgery that could have cost her life, describing the experience as both terrifying and transformative.

“I could have lost my life in June,” she wrote. ” What I went through was horrific and ended with an unplanned surgery and strangely, the surgery itself was the least dramatic part of it all.”

Adesua explained that the incident occurred while she was in the UK for two speaking engagements.

She credited divine intervention for her survival, noting that every event of that day aligned perfectly to save her life.

“If even one single detail had been different, I wouldn’t be here today. When I think about it, I shudder” she said.

The Sugar Rush actress said the ordeal deepened her faith and renewed her gratitude for life.

“There’s nothing anyone can tell me, God is real,” she declared.

She went on to urge her followers to cherish each day and embody compassion.

“Let’s choose to be softer, kinder, gentler, forgiving, patient, loving, and peaceful. I’ll never take another day for granted, neither should you,” she added.
